编程发展背景怎么写好一点

时间:2025-03-04 20:31:46 明星趣事

编程的发展背景可以从以下几个方面进行阐述:

技术革新的推动

计算机的诞生与发展:计算机的诞生可以追溯到19世纪末,艾伦·图灵的工作为现代计算机科学奠定了基础。

早期编程语言:20世纪50年代,Fortran和Cobol等编程语言的出现,使得程序员能够更方便地编写代码,这些语言成为了编程的基础。

结构化编程:20世纪60年代和70年代,结构化编程成为主流,通过引入控制结构和子程序的概念,使程序的逻辑结构更清晰、更易读、更易维护。

互联网和开源软件:互联网的普及和开源软件的兴起,极大地推动了编程技术的发展,编程成为了一个热门领域,吸引了越来越多的人关注和参与。

社会和经济需求

信息技术的发展:随着信息技术的不断进步,编程技术已成为现代社会不可或缺的基础设施之一,从个人电脑的普及到大数据、云计算、人工智能等新兴技术的崛起,编程技术发挥了重要作用。

社会经济结构转型:计算机编程行业的发展背景也涵盖了社会经济结构转型的需求,特别是在互联网时代,编程技术对于推动经济发展和产业升级具有重要作用。

编程语言和工具的发展

编程语言:从最初的机器语言到高级语言的发展,如Python、Java等,编程语言不断进化,使得编程更加高效和易于理解。

编程工具:集成开发环境(IDE)、文本编辑器、调试器等工具的出现,使得程序开发更加高效和易于管理。

软件开发和团队协作

软件开发流程:遵循合理的软件开发流程,如需求分析、设计、编码、测试、文档编写等,能够提高编程效率,减少错误和漏洞。

团队协作与项目管理:在编程创作过程中,团队协作和项目管理能力也是非常重要的,了解和掌握这些技能能够提高团队的效率和作品的质量。

综上所述,编程的发展背景是一个不断演进和变革的过程,受到技术革新、社会需求、编程语言和工具的发展以及软件开发和团队协作等多方面的影响。